An Arcadia 12% bulb is a good one -- distance would be 12-15 inches inside the tank or 8-10 on top of the screen - both distances basking decor directly underneath - it needs to be in a fixture w/ a reflector-- you would need a 24" fixture for that bulb--- you can look here for both the bulb and fixture www.pangeareptiles.com -there is a fixture there for $32 do not use the bulb that comes w/ that fixture
